Introducing Samuel Adams HeliYUM (Curated Video)

Introducing Samuel Adams HeliYUM (Curated Video)

Jim Koch, founder of the Boston Beer Co. and Samuel Adams beer introduces it helium beer Samuel Adams HeliYUM to commemorate April 1, 2014.

"While devoting ourselves to the 'Noble' pursuit of perfecting the flavor of Noble Hops we've been exploring Noble Gasses as well. Lightened from heavier gases like CO2, HeliYum takes advantages of the properties of helium -- one of the noble gases -- for a truly remarkable brew. Helium's unique index of refraction creates brilliant clarity while providing an incredibly light mouth feel. Since Helium is an odorless gas, it doesn't compete with the natural aromas of the ingredients. From a freshness perspective, helium doesn't oxidize which allows for a much longer shelf life."
